Two-time "Formula 1" champion and Aston Martin driver Fernando Alonso answered a question about which Real Madrid football team player he would compare himself to.
According to Idman.Biz, Alonso compared himself to Valverde.
"That's a good question. Probably Valverde. He works very hard, and it's not always obvious. At the same time, he is extremely competitive. I think he has that competitive spirit," DANZ quoted Alonso as saying.
44-year-old Alonso is in 12th place in the overall "Formula 1" drivers' standings with 37 points. McLaren driver Lando Norris leads with 357 points.
